An N response to this prompt returns you to the Filer command level. If yourespond v, the Filer examines the blocks in the specified range andfrequently returns a report something like this:Block 23 may be OKBloc~ 24 may be OKBlock 25 may be OKIn this case the bad blocks are probably fixed. Occasionally, however, thereport may be something like this instead:Block 23 may be OKBlock 24 is badBlock 25 is badFile(s) endangered:THISFILE.TEXT 18 24THATFILE.CODE 25 29Mark bad blocks ? (Files will be removed !) CY/N)In this case the Filer is offering you the option of marking the block( s) itcould not fix. If you respond with v to this question, the Filer first removesall files containing those bad blocks that could not be fixed and thencreates a file on the disk named BAD. BAD exactly covers the bad blocks. Ifthe bad blocks are not contiguous, more than one BAD file will be created.Once this is done, you are advised:&.WarningBad blocks markedand the Filer command line reappears on your screen. On the disk directory,you will find a new entry which saysBAD. !Hl024. BADBlocks in a file marked .BAD will not be used to store any of your files, andwill not be shifted during a Krunch operation. These dangerous areas onyour disk are thus rendered effectively harmless.When you first format or zero a disk, it is a good idea to do a bad-blocks scanso that you can conveniently mark any bad blocks and save yourself a lot oftrouble in the future.A block which has been "fixed" may still contain useless garbage. Themessage MAY BE OK should be translated as "is probably physicallyOK." Examining a block means that the information stored in the block isread into memory, stored again at the same spot, and then read again. Ifboth readings are the same, the block is probably all right physically andis not declared BAD. This says nothing about the information containedin the block.The Filer CommandsIl-69
